Dear Ministry support team,

AS you know I have been going down and working in the same areas of Mexico with teams for the last 11 years. Once again I am leading a team of about 40 people down to build and do ministry the first of Jan. 2011. I am excited about getting to once again start the year off with a missions trip.

I just got an update letter from our Missionary down in Mexico who we will be working with the first week of Jan. 2011. There is a lot of great info about the exciting ministry that we will be doing, but I also got some bad news about our building project. As usual we have plans to build a house for a family. This year we are planned to build a house for a family who will be working at a local church. 2 years ago our team built an addition to a house for the parents of this family, so it is exciting to continue working with this great and well deserving family.

The bad news is that they are in need of some different material then we are used to using as well the prices of material has GONE UP!!!! So we are in need of some last min help. Our normal plans are to pay about $2,400 for a house, but we just found out that the cost is about $4,200. This is almost double what we had planned. I was already worried about us being able to cover our cost of the $2,400 as the financial situation of this trip so far is TIGHT!!!!!

Our missionary down there has offered to help cover some of the difference, but I would really like to see if we can try to come together as a team and help cover this difference.
